Carlos Falchi's technicolor faux-skin bags for Target aren't supposed to hit stores until November 1st, but they've made their way to the Atlantic Terminal location a few days early. The selection isn't huge, but the entire line seems to be there, from the big slouchy satchels for $49.99 to the mini-purses for $19.99. Since it's Target, don't expect killer quality—no one is going to look at these bags and accuse the wearer of python abuse. Still, the colors are rich, the price is right, and each bag comes with a pebbly little Carlos Falchi tag, which suggests that someone over there was paying attention to the details.
